I am rebuilding PD clutch in a 200. The 2 driving hubs that drive the clutch disc have little worn spots where the disc spines engage to hubs. My question is how much wear can these hubs have and still be usable? Thanks, Sam

If youve got over 3/32 deep wear groove sId look at replacements. The discs need to slide a little on the hubs, with to much groove they can bind which accelerates wear on the clutch splines themselves. Hope its warmer down there than it is here +5 right now. HTH
